Pittman® ELCOM SL® Brushless DC Motors Feature Slotless Design For Optimized Performance



PITTMAN® ELCOM SL® brushless DC servo motors feature a slotless stator design offering key performance advantages compared with conventional slotted technology. These motors are ideal for applications including data storage, medical/biotech, semiconductor, automation, commercial aviation, and others requiring high performance and reliability.

Advantages from their slotless stator construction include negligible magnetic cogging to enable extremely smooth, quiet motion; low inductance and high current bandwidth to promote precise control, especially during rapid acceleration in demanding incremental motion applications; a large magnetic air gap minimizing viscous torque losses for efficient operation at high speeds; and excellent winding heat transfer allowing for high thermal efficiency and transient load capacity.

PITTMAN ELCOM SL brushless DC servo motors are available in three frame sizes (Series 3400, 4400, and 5400) with 3-phase slotless stators and 4-pole rotors with neodymium magnets. Speeds up to 8,000 RPM can be achieved (higher speeds are available upon request). Peak torques can range from 13.3 oz-in to 195 oz-in, depending on model.

All motors feature precision-ground hardened stainless steel shafts and rugged construction. Their modular design accommodates customization with components to meet the particular application requirements. Options include cables, shaft-mounted pulleys and gears, ball bearings, multiple windings, electromechanical brakes, and optical encoders, among others.
